Established in 1999 by legislative mandate and visionary leadership, this statewide network of 12 public, two-year institutions has evolved from a fragmented collection of vocational schools into a cohesive, powerhouse educational entity that is redefining the path to prosperity for hundreds of thousands of Pelican State residents. Headquartered in Baton Rouge and strategically positioned across 53 of Louisiana’s 64 parishes, LCTCS is far more than a collection of campuses; it is a vital engine driving workforce development, community revitalization, and social mobility throughout urban, suburban, and rural Louisiana.

A Mission Rooted in Service and Opportunity

At its core, the LCTCS mission is elegantly profound: “to improve the quality of life of Louisiana’s citizens through educational programs offered through our colleges.” This mission is executed through a dual commitment: preparing students for immediate, high-wage employment in critical industries and providing a seamless, affordable pathway for academic transfer to four-year universities. Unlike traditional four-year institutions, LCTCS colleges operate on the fundamental principle of open admissions, actively breaking down geographic, financial, and academic barriers that often prevent non-traditional, first-generation, and underserved students from pursuing postsecondary education.
This commitment to inclusivity is paired with an unwavering focus on workforce alignment. Every program, from nursing to process technology, cybersecurity to culinary arts, is meticulously designed in close partnership with regional employers, industry leaders, and economic development boards.
This symbiotic relationship ensures that LCTCS graduates possess the precise, hands-on skills and industry-recognized credentials that local businesses desperately need.
